要使输入占位符文本可编辑,可以使用HTML和CSS来实现。以下是一种常见的实现方式:
HTML代码:
<input type="text" placeholder="请输入文本" id="myInput">
CSS代码:
input[type="text"]::placeholder {
color: #999; /* 设置占位符文本的颜色 */
}
input[type="text"]:focus::placeholder {
color: #ccc; /* 设置获取焦点时占位符文本的颜色 */
}
解释:
<input>
元素创建一个文本输入框,并设置type="text"
表示输入类型为文本。<input>
元素中使用placeholder
属性来设置占位符文本的内容。::placeholder
伪元素来选择占位符文本,并设置其样式。可以通过color
属性来设置占位符文本的颜色。:focus
伪类来选择获取焦点时的状态,并设置获取焦点时占位符文本的样式。这样,当用户点击文本输入框时,占位符文本会变为可编辑状态,用户可以输入自己的文本。当用户输入内容后,占位符文本会自动消失。
推荐的腾讯云相关产品:无
请注意,以上答案仅供参考,具体实现方式可能因具体情况而异。
领取专属 10元无门槛券
手把手带您无忧上云